Applications:

  • Ideal for replacing existing ground wires and upgrading aging transmission lines.

  • Suitable for use on lower-grade lines such as GJ50/70/90, among others.

Main Features:

  • Compact cable diameter and lightweight design minimize additional load on towers.

  • Centralized steel tube construction prevents secondary mechanical fatigue damage.

  • Offers low resistance to lateral pressure, torsion, and tensile forces (single-layer structure).

Type test

Type testing may be exempted if the manufacturer provides certificates for similar products tested by an internationally recognized and independent testing organization or laboratory.

If type testing is required, it will be conducted based on a mutually agreed-upon test procedure between the purchaser and the manufacturer.

Routine test

Optical attenuation coefficients are measured on all production cable lengths in accordance with IEC 60793-1-CIC using the backscattering (OTDR) method.

Standard single-mode fibers are tested at wavelengths of 1310 nm and 1550 nm, while non-zero dispersion-shifted (NZDS) fibers are tested at 1550 nm.

Factory test

Factory acceptance testing is performed on two cable samples per order, witnessed by the customer or their representative.

The quality requirements and evaluation criteria are based on applicable standards and pre-agreed quality plans.
